Transaction 680ee7ac224abd8b7f76a1911ba2a0f73260918f82c4697e8580026bffbd717a
3 Input
2 Outputs
- 680ee7ac224abd8b7f76a1911ba2a0f73260918f82c4697e8580026bffbd717a:0
- 680ee7ac224abd8b7f76a1911ba2a0f73260918f82c4697e8580026bffbd717a:1
value 7649392
address 168qmUDSfG7h2iGGskFFRwAxSdgDv29pFR
value 31558156
address 1BLvZXjACu3KB9RwGcovTz2FzFAUuVrity